Samsung washing machine, power on immediately spins
This case is rather unique
When the washing machine runs at 4am
Suddenly when I was about to rinse the last, the pulsator in the middle kept rotating.
Even though the board has only been used for 7 months.
The board was checked, and the 2 triacs were damaged
Compare for components from former Samsung boards, the Triac transistor seems to be short
2 Triacs BCR12FM 14L from the old board moved to the new board
Reassembled, and the engine is running
After the machine seems to work normally
Suddenly the Samsung washing machine returned to the problem
Motor rotation does not move
Motor washing machine just buzzing, not turn.
Checked the 2 triac units again, normal as the previous installation
Finally, the back of the washing machine was dismantled
Because there are allegations that the capacitor unit does not provide enough power or is damaged
So that the motor of the washing machine hums
Like a fan that doesn't want to spin, if the capacitor was broken
Once released, just visible.
One red wire, like hanging
Not yet broken, left one copper fiber
The power cable to the capacitor is removed and reinstalled into the socket
Just reinstalled into the capacitor, and the capacitor is re-attached to its original position
After trying again, the machine looks normal.
Until this video was made, there were 3 washing processes with 1 soak washing mode

Suggestions for repairing a Samsung washing machine with the above conditions
First step. Be sure to check the capacitor unit
Discharge before discharge
Measure the capacitor of the Samsung washing machine with a multimeter
If conditions are good, check the cable, and plug it back in.
Next
Check the Triac transistor unit as a motor drive unit or provide motor power
Check the triac by checking for a short and not on the left and right leg transistor.
If short, replace the unit
Cause Samsung washing machine buzzing, possible problem in the capacitor
The washing machine immediately turns, damage to the triac.
Cause of Triac breakdown. If only one, the rotation only leads to one side.
Damage to both, due to the electrical load for the motor is in the Triac. The unit capacitor does not provide thrust assistance.
Capacitor breakdown, weak capacitor. The impact of slow rotation of the drum and pulsator.
Until the sound in the Samsung washing machine buzzes.

Secure DNS in Google Chrome is a privacy and security feature that utilizes DNS-over-HTTPS (DoH). Instead of sending your website requests in plain text—which anyone on your network could see—it encrypts them, ensuring your ISP or a hacker on public Wi-Fi cant track which sites you are visiting.

Privacy: Encrypts your DNS lookups so your browsing history is harder to intercept.
Security: Prevents DNS spoofing or hijacking, where an attacker redirects you to a fake phishing website.
Integrity: Ensures that the IP address Chrome receives is the genuine one for the site you requested.
Performance: Often faster than default ISP servers when using high-speed providers like Cloudflare or Google.
How to Enable Secure DNS
Open Chrome and click the three dots (⋮) in the top-right corner.
Select Settings - Privacy and security.
Click on Security.
Scroll down to the Advanced section.
Toggle Use secure DNS to On.
Automatic: Uses your current service provider (if they support DoH).
With [Provider]: Allows you to choose a custom provider like Cloudflare (1.1.1.1), Google (8.8.8.8), or CleanBrowsing (for family filtering).
Troubleshooting Setting is Disabled
If the option is greyed out or says its managed by your organization, it is usually due to:
Work/School Managed Devices: Administrators often lock these settings to enforce network policies.
Parental Controls: Windows or macOS family safety features may override browser DNS.
Registry Policies: Sometimes malware or old software leaves behind policies that disable the toggle. You can check these by typing chrome://policy in your address bar. Setting Secure DNS Windows 11 Browser](https://i.ytimg.com/vi/qBqvnumuu3Q/mqdefault.jpg)
